Itinerary Highlights
The tour starts with a midnight pickup from your hotel in Yogyakarta, followed by a journey to the stunning Dieng Plateau.
Here, you’ll hike to the Sikunir Hill for a breathtaking sunrise view over 8 volcanoes. Next, you’ll visit Batu Pandang Hill to witness the ‘Colourful Lake’ and explore the Sikidang Crater, with its bubbling mud and steam.
The tour then takes you to the Arjuna Temple Complex, where you’ll discover eight small Hindu temples from the 7th century.
The day concludes with a guided tour and climb-up access to the magnificent Borobudur Temple, the largest Buddhist structure on Earth.

What Is the Dress Code for the Borobudur Temple Visit?
The dress code for visiting Borobudur Temple is modest attire. Visitors should wear long pants or skirts that cover the knees and shirts that cover the shoulders. Proper footwear is also required to explore the temple grounds.
Are There Any Physical Fitness Requirements to Participate in This Tour?
There are no specific physical fitness requirements to participate in this tour. However, guests should be able to hike for up to 1.5 hours to reach Sikunir Hill and climb the 72 steps to access Borobudur Temple.
